1. Patient Selection and Evaluation

The first crucial step towards a successful dental implantation is proper patient selection and thorough evaluation. Candidates for implants should be assessed for overall health, as conditions like diabetes, heart disease, or autoimmune disorders can affect healing and recovery. A comprehensive medical history is necessary to identify any potential complications that might arise during the process.
Moreover, the patient’s oral health must also be evaluated. Issues such as gum disease, inadequate bone density, or tooth decay need to be treated prior to implantation. A well-planned examination will help the dentist establish whether bone grafting or other preparatory procedures are needed, thus optimizing the success of the implant procedure.
Lastly, consideration of the patient’s lifestyle is essential. Factors such as smoking and oral hygiene practices play a vital role in healing and long-term success. Patients who maintain good habits and commit to regular dental check-ups are likely to have better outcomes following their implant surgeries.
2. Pre-operative Measures for Success
Once patient selection is complete, pre-operative measures must be taken to ensure the procedure’s success. The first action is to provide patients with education regarding the surgery. Understanding the process can reduce anxiety and help patients prepare mentally. Discussing what to expect before, during, and after the surgery helps build trust and informed consent.
Additionally, a pre-operative dental cleaning is often recommended. This cleaning helps to minimize bacteria in the mouth, which can lower the risk of infection during and after the procedure. It serves to establish a clean environment for implantation, thus enhancing healing and implant stability.
Finally, patients may need to modify their medication regimen prior to surgery. Some medications can interfere with healing or blood clotting, so a thorough review by the dental surgeon is essential. Proper pre-operative instructions regarding the use of prescribed medications, pain management, and dietary restrictions set the stage for successful implantation.
3. Surgical Techniques and Considerations
The surgical phase of dental implantation requires precision and expertise. Utilizing modern techniques and technology, including 3D imaging, can significantly improve the accuracy of implant placement. This level of detail helps prevent complications associated with the misplacement of implants, such as damage to adjacent teeth or nervous tissue.
Surgeons should also consider the timing of the implantation. Immediate implant placement, where the implant is placed right after tooth extraction, can be an option for certain patients. However, this requires careful assessment, as it may not be suitable for everyone. By optimizing the timing, the chances of successful osseointegration—the process whereby the implant fuses with jawbone—can be enhanced.
Post-surgery, close monitoring of the healing process is crucial. Regular follow-up appointments allow the dental team to assess the integration of the implant and address any concerns promptly. Following the prescribed osteointegration timeline assures that the implant bonds effectively and functions well within the dental arch.
4. Postoperative Care and Maintenance
Postoperative care is as important as the pre-operative and surgical stages. After dental implantation, patients should follow a carefully outlined aftercare routine to ensure optimal healing. This includes adhering to dietary restrictions, where soft foods are encouraged while avoiding hot, spicy foods that could irritate the area.
Maintaining excellent oral hygiene is essential in preventing infections that can jeopardize the implants success. Patients should be instructed on proper brushing techniques around the implant site and the importance of regular flossing. Using antimicrobial mouth rinses can further support healing and minimize bacterial growth.
Finally, attending follow-up visits for professional cleanings and examinations is fundamental. These visits enable the dental team to monitor the health of the implant and surrounding tissues, ensuring any potential issues are caught and addressed early, thereby preserving the integrity of the implant.
